Odahviing ( in dragon language) is an ally of and right-hand dragon to Alduin. The Dragonborn must summon him to an encounter during the main quest. His name means "Winged Snow Hunter" in the language of dragons.

Interactions
The Fallen
In order to find the final location of Alduin, the Dragonborn must capture and interrogate Odahviing. To lure Odahviing into the trap, the Dragonborn must use Dragonrend to force him to land, and walk backwards into Dragonsreach, causing him to be trapped. While captured, Odahviing bargains with the Dragonborn for his freedom. For his release, he trades the Dragonborn his loyalty and safe passage to Alduin's temple of Skuldafn, high in the eastern mountains and reachable only by flight.
Epilogue
After the Dragonborn slays Alduin and is shouted back to the Throat of the World, the Dragons acknowledge the Dragonborn's Thu'um and began flying out and shouting, with Paarthurnax pledging to lead the Dragons and teach them the Way of the Voice. Odahviing then came down to the Dragonborn, wishing Paarthurnax success on his quest to make the dragons follow the Way of the Voice.
Odahviing was already impressed twice over after the battle and pledged his life to the service of the Dragonborn, claiming that he will come to the aid of the Dragonborn whenever the Dragonborn needs help, if he can. Then he flies away and later can be seen circling the top of the Throat of the World.

Summoning
Once freed, Odahviing becomes a friendly Dragon that helps the Dragonborn. He can be summoned by using the Call Dragon shout which is learned during the quest The Fallen. He may only be summoned outdoors.
Behavior
- When Odahviing is called, he will not harm followers, nor will they harm him. This includes any Legion or Stormcloak members assisted. Odahviing, however, becomes hostile toward Shadowmere.
- If Odahviing takes too much damage in battle, he will land and stop fighting.
- He prefers to battle from the sky and is still affected by area of effect spells, such as Lightning Cloak or Fireball.
- Odahviing, when called to battle a fellow dragon, may enter aerial combat with the hostile dragon.
- He fights until all hostiles are dispatched.

Trivia
- Odahviing can be seen flying around the top of the Throat of the World once the Call Dragon shout has been obtained.
- He is the last being to speak with the Dragonborn when they return from Sovngarde.
- After his capture, Farengar Secret-Fire will come to examine him, wanting to perform tests and gather samples. He moves around to Odahviing's hindquarters, then Odahviing will shout in pain and let off a burst of fire. Farengar will then flee afterwards.
- Odahviing is voiced by Canadian actor Charles Dennis.
- He is one of the few named dragons that can be mounted, with the addition of the The Elder Scrolls V: Dragonborn add-on. He also has unique audio differing from the other dragons.
